Răsfoiți Sursa

Merge pull request #50 from Sh3B0/patch-1

Use ansible_env fact instead of lookup plugin as the latter queries controller instead of remote
Christian Lempa 3 ani în urmă
părinte
comite
19886fe068
1 a modificat fișierele cu 6 adăugiri și 3 ștergeri
  1. 6 3
      ansible/provisoning/ubuntu/install-docker.yaml

+ 6 - 3
ansible/provisoning/ubuntu/install-docker.yaml

@@ -33,8 +33,11 @@
         - containerd.io
       update_cache: yes
 
-  - name: add userpermissions
-    shell: "usermod -aG docker {{ lookup('env','USER') }}"
+  - name: add user permissions
+    shell: "usermod -aG docker {{ ansible_env.SUDO_USER }}"
+
+  - name: Reset ssh connection for changes to take effect
+    meta: "reset_connection"
 
   # Installs Docker SDK
   # --
@@ -44,7 +47,7 @@
       name: python3-pip
   
   - name: install python sdk
-    become_user: "{{ lookup('env','USER') }}"
+    become_user: "{{ ansible_env.SUDO_USER }}"
     pip:
       name:
         - docker